Same below with V4L2_PIX_FMT_Y10, V4L2_PIX_FMT_Y12 > > > and V4L2_PIX_FMT_Y16. > > > > mmm, the SRGB mbus codes come from the R-Car ISP input image format. > > I understand these are multiple identical entries, but having > > somewhere a translation from SRGB->Y formats just to have fewer > > entries here it feels a bit of an hack handling the CFA pattern in the media bus code and pixel format was a historical mistake that we're slowly addressing for new drivers. Sakari has for instance posted patches to use the Y formats only on sensor subdevs that will follow the new raw camera sensor subdev model. I think we should use Y formats in the VSP and ISP drivers already. > > > This would still duplicate entries, as V4L2_PIX_FMT_Y1[026] are > > > essentially treated the same, and they are identical to > > > V4L2_PIX_FMT_RGB565.
